Course description:
This course provides students with professional behavior guidelines, including suggestions on the standards of appearance, actions and attitude in the business environment, and handling a variety of social and business situations, networking meetings, and meals. Instructional methods include: a study guide, required readings, and a final exam.
3 credits, lower level
